About Viagogo:

Viagogo is a global online platform for live sport, music and entertainment tickets. Viagogo aims to provide ticket buyers with the widest possible choice of tickets to events across the world and helps ticket sellers ranging from individuals with a spare ticket to large multi-national event organizers reach a global audience.

    DO NOT USE THIS SERVICE (really they are a disservice) to paying customers. I bought two tickets to a Justin Timberlake for my wife for Christmas. Concert in Jan. in DC. Right side and in front of the stage on the first level of arena. When I got the link to download the tickets they were for a show in another city in April! I contacted customer service and they gave me a link to other tickets I could choose from. Great I thought. Well they tickets they gave me to choose from were behind the stage or on very highest level of the arena. I went to their web site and they were selling two tickets in the same section I bought mine but they would let me exchange for those tickets because they were more expensive than the two I bought in the SAME section! They said it’s “policy” to replace for the same price but not the same view. They won’t budge and you can’t speak to a manager. This is a huge rip-off. NEVER use this service!
